Step 1: To begin making Aam Pudina Ka Panna Recipe, wash the mangoes remove the stems and add it to a pressure cooker with 2 cups of water
Step 2: Pressure cook for 4-5 whistles and turn off the heat
Step 3: Allow the pressure to release naturally
Step 4: Once done open the pressure cooker and remove the mangoes from the pressure cooker
Step 5: Save some of the water the mangoes were boiled in
Step 6: Let it cool down
Step 7: Remove the skin and take the pulp of the mango
Step 8: Add the mango pulp to a mixer grinder
Step 9: Take cleaned and wash mint leaves and mix it with the mango pulp
Step 10: Churn it at high speed in your grinder till mango pulp and mint leaves are well combined
Step 11: Transfer the churned mixture to the bowl which has the mango water which was saved after boiling the mangoes
Step 12: Stir well to combine
Step 13: Once done add cumin powder, black salt, juice of lemon and stir well to combine
Step 14: You can add Jaggery if you like to make the aam panna sweet
Step 15: Taste and adjust the seasoning to suit your taste
Step 16: Add cold water and mix everything properly
Step 17: Next, heat a small tadka pan with ghee
Step 18: Add cumin seeds, asafoetida and let the cumin seeds splutter
Step 19: After the seeds have spluttered mix this tadka into the Aam Panna and give it a mix
Step 20: Pour the Aam Pudina ka Panna into serving glasses with ice in it and serve
